Abstract

This study proposes a model of danger of ignition of wildfires in Galicia, the Spanish region with more fires recorded annually caused mostly by human causes.

The model is based on the one proposed by Chuvieco et al. (2014), improving the spatial resolution from 1000 to 500 m, creating specific layers of human and natural causality and keeping methods of obtaining the status of the living and dead fuel. The process has been automated using Python.

The causalities were modeled by GWLR, obtaining an overall reliability of 75% for human and 94% for naturally occurring fires. These variables are combined using a probabilistic approach for obtained the danger of ignition due to the causal agent. The new layer is integrated with the danger associated to the moisture content of the fuel (alive and dead) for obtained the danger of ignition of wildfires. The model validation was performed from the hot spots of MODIS in the summer of 2013, obtaining a 60% success where low danger areas with hot spots are related to high values of human occurrence.
